Correct torquing procedure done on front wheel hub units using a Ford Explorer as an example.
Detailed Description
Watch Russ, an ASE certified tech, demonstrate the steps needed to achieve proper torque. Starting with the Ford Explorer on a car lift, Russ demonstrates the first part of the correct torquing procedure. After the SUV is lowered onto the ground he demonstrates how to correctly perform final torque on a vehicle.

17-24 ft lbs is what I found for 1998 rear wheel drive Ford Explorer. Does this sound correct? That is a big difference from 184 ft lbs. I know this vid is for a different year and probably a 4x4. I looked it up in your torque guide and it says FT2. What is FT2?
@witchfindergeneral13
@witchfindergeneral13 8 лет назад
I looked it up in your torque guide and it says FT2. What is FT2?
@SKFPartsInfo
@SKFPartsInfo 8 лет назад
FT2 is the Adjustment Procedure code that is looked up in the back of the torque spec guide under 'Adjustment Proceduer'. It reads: "Tighten hub nut to 17-24 ft-lbs/22-34 Nm while turning wheel. Loosen nut 175 degrees and tighten to 17 in-lbs/2 Nm". The FT2 procedure is correct for a 1998 2WD Explorer. The Procedure in the video is for installation of an SKF X-Tracker hub assembly unit. The 1998 2WD Explorer torque procedure is used when replacing taper bearings and seal in a rotor and hub unit. Different types of torque are needed depending on the design of the part and the year of the vehicle.
